My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Handsome, striking Inuit was found outside by our TNR department and was admitted to us in October. He has fur as soft as a rabbit, but what is not so soft is his voice. Inuit is deaf, and as a result his cry can be louder than other cats’. One of his fosters says that he enjoys lulling around people, and wants to always be touching a person. If you are just sitting by him, he may reach out a paw to rest on you, letting you know he’s there for you. Inuit is very curious, and loves the laser pointer, wand toys, and exploring. If there is a person in the home, he will follow her wherever she goes. Lastly, Inuit is very food motivated! Give him a treat to win him over. DOB: 2011
